版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领
文档简介
CMMI软件质量管理体系实施全流程软件质量管理的成熟度直接决定企业的交付能力与市场竞争力。CMMI(CapabilityMaturityModelIntegration)作为全球公认的软件过程改进框架,其实施过程需要系统性规划与精细化落地。本文将从实战角度拆解CMMI实施的全流程,结合行业最佳实践与典型场景,为企业提供从筹备到持续改进的完整路径。一、前期筹备:锚定实施的基础坐标组织现状深度调研是实施的起点。需从流程成熟度、文化适配性、能力基线三个维度展开:流程成熟度:通过访谈研发、测试、项目管理等团队,梳理现有开发流程(如瀑布、敏捷混合模式)、文档管理规范、缺陷处理机制等,识别“无流程”“流程流于形式”“流程执行不一致”三类问题。文化适配性:评估团队对变革的接受度(如是否习惯“按流程做事”),若团队偏向“自由发挥”,需提前设计文化过渡策略(如通过试点项目展示流程价值)。能力基线:分析人员技能(如需求分析师的需求建模能力)、工具使用情况(如是否使用版本控制工具),为后续培训与工具选型提供依据。实施目标需精准对齐业务战略。若企业以“提升交付效率”为核心目标,可优先聚焦CMMIML3的项目管理(PP、PMC)与工程过程(REQM、RD)域;若需满足客户对“量化管理”的要求,则需规划向ML4/5进阶,重点建设度量体系与过程性能模型。资源保障体系需同步构建:人员配置:组建EPG(工程过程组),成员涵盖流程专家、QA、技术骨干,明确“流程设计-执行-监控”的职责分工。预算规划:预留培训(如CMMI主任评估师内训)、工具采购(如需求管理工具DOORS)、正式评估(约占项目总预算15%)的费用。工具选型:优先选择与现有技术栈兼容的工具(如用Git替代SVN做配置管理),降低团队学习成本。二、差距诊断:厘清现状与目标的鸿沟现状评估需对标CMMI过程域。以CMMI-DEV为例,需覆盖16个过程域(如需求管理REQM、项目策划PP、配置管理CM等):针对项目管理域,检查“项目计划是否明确各阶段里程碑、资源分配是否合理”;针对工程域,评审“需求文档是否包含验收标准、代码评审是否覆盖关键模块”;针对支持域,验证“缺陷跟踪工具是否记录缺陷根源、配置项版本是否可追溯”。差距识别需区分类型与优先级:流程缺失型:如无需求评审流程,导致需求变更率超30%;执行不足型:如代码评审仅“走形式”,评审发现的缺陷占比不足10%;工具支撑型:如无自动化测试工具,回归测试耗时占比超40%。通过优先级矩阵(影响度×可行性)排序,优先解决“高影响-易改进”的差距(如优化需求评审流程,可快速降低变更率)。最终输出《差距分析报告》,明确“现状-差距-原因-改进建议”,为体系设计提供依据。三、体系设计:构建适配的质量管理框架过程体系需结构化分层:主流程:定义项目全生命周期(如立项-需求-设计-开发-测试-交付)的阶段入口/出口准则(如需求冻结后才能进入设计阶段);子流程:细化各阶段的活动(如需求开发需包含“需求捕获-分析-评审-基线化”);操作指南:提供模板(如需求规格说明书模板)、检查单(如代码评审检查单)、案例库(如需求变更处理案例),确保流程“可落地”。文档体系需平衡标准化与灵活性:核心文档(如《过程手册》)需明确“谁在什么场景下做什么事”,但避免过度冗余(如将“每日站会”流程简化为“3个问题:昨天做了什么、今天计划做什么、障碍是什么”);针对敏捷项目,设计“轻量级”流程(如将需求评审与迭代计划会合并),避免流程僵化。工具链需协同整合:需求管理工具(如Jama)需与测试管理工具(如TestRail)打通,实现“需求-测试用例-缺陷”的双向追溯;引入DevOps工具链(如Jenkins+SonarQube),将代码质量检查、自动化测试嵌入持续集成流程,提升过程效率。四、试点验证:小范围验证体系有效性试点项目需具备典型性:选择“规模中等、团队配合度高、业务场景复杂”的项目(如电商系统的订单模块开发),验证流程在“需求变更频繁、多团队协作”场景下的适应性。过程试运行需强化监控:用过程绩效指标(如需求评审通过率、缺陷发现阶段分布)量化执行效果;每日站会收集“流程卡点”(如审批环节耗时过长),每周复盘优化(如将“需求变更审批”从“三级审批”简化为“项目经理+客户确认”)。迭代优化需快速闭环:针对试点中暴露的问题(如“代码评审效率低”),通过“头脑风暴+数据分析”定位根因(如评审标准不明确),2周内完成流程优化(如制定《代码评审速查表》),再通过下一个迭代验证效果。五、推广部署:全组织级的体系落地分层培训需因材施教:管理层:通过“战略对齐”培训(如“CMMI如何支撑交付周期缩短20%”),获得资源支持;执行层:开展“实操工作坊”(如需求文档编写演练、缺陷跟踪系统使用培训),结合“反面案例”(如某项目因需求管理混乱导致延期)强化认知;QA团队:培训“过程审计方法”(如如何抽样检查项目文档、访谈团队成员),确保体系合规性。全流程实施需动态监控:建立过程仪表盘,实时展示“需求变更率、评审通过率、缺陷逃逸率”等指标,发现异常(如需求变更率突增)立即预警;推行“过程Owner责任制”,每个过程域指定负责人(如需求管理由需求组长负责),确保问题有人跟进。内部审计需常态化:每月抽查30%的在研项目,检查“流程执行合规性、文档完整性、工具使用规范性”,输出《审计报告》并跟踪整改,避免“体系上墙不上心”。六、评估改进:从合规到卓越的进阶内部预评估需模拟真实场景:组建“内部评估团队”,按照SCAMPIA(正式评估)标准,抽查5-8个项目的证据(如项目计划、需求文档、度量数据),识别“证据不充分”“过程域覆盖不全”等问题,提前整改。正式评估需精准准备:整理证据库(每个过程域需提供“3-5个项目的文档+访谈记录+度量数据”),确保证据“可追溯、可验证”;与评估师充分沟通,展示“体系的实际运行效果”(如通过量化数据证明“需求变更率从35%降至15%”),而非“仅满足文档合规”。持续改进需构建闭环:建立度量体系,跟踪“缺陷密度、生产率、客户满意度”等指标,通过数据分析识别改进机会(如某模块缺陷密度高,需优化设计评审流程);结合行业趋势(如DevOps、AI辅助开发),每半年迭代一次体系(如将“自动化测试覆盖率”纳入过程目标),实现从“合规”到“卓越”的跨越。结语:CMMI实施的本质是“文化变革”CMMI的价值不仅在于“拿证书”,更在于通过流程优化、量化管理、持续改进,将“质量管理
温馨提示
- 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
- 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
- 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
- 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
- 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
- 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
- 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。
最新文档
- 2026年医院实习生公寓装修合同
- 2026年重大科研项目合作合同
- 2026年黄金租赁合同
- 2025年乡村振兴智能化服务体系建设项目可行性研究报告
- 2025年特种工程机械研发与制造项目可行性研究报告
- 2025年远程医疗健康管理可行性研究报告
- 2025年数字货币交易系统开发可行性研究报告
- 停产停产协议书
- 网页维护合同范本
- 田亩转租合同范本
- 上海财经大学2026年辅导员及其他非教学科研岗位人员招聘备考题库带答案详解
- 2026湖北恩施州建始县教育局所属事业单位专项招聘高中教师28人备考笔试试题及答案解析
- 心肺康复课件
- 2025中原农业保险股份有限公司招聘67人笔试参考题库附带答案详解(3卷)
- 骶部炎性窦道的护理
- 2025人民法院出版社社会招聘8人(公共基础知识)测试题附答案解析
- 多元催化体系下羊毛脂转酯化制备胆固醇的工艺解析与效能探究
- 上海市奉贤区2026届高三一模英语试题
- 设施设备综合安全管理制度以及安全设施、设备维护、保养和检修、维修制
- 2025届高考全国二卷第5题说题课件
- 2026福建春季高考语文总复习:名篇名句默写(知识梳理+考点)原卷版
评论
0/150
提交评论